Ver Mensaje Individual
  #1 (permalink)  
Antiguo 03/02/2010, 09:00
juandedios
 
Fecha de Ingreso: mayo-2003
Ubicación: Lima
Mensajes: 967
Antigüedad: 21 años
Puntos: 8
Funcion para mostrar filas de una tabla

Hola, tengo una clase y dentro una funcion que supuestamente tiene que mostrarme los registros de una tabla, pero no sale nada y no muestra ningun error, la funcion es esta:
Código PHP:
public function MostrarNoticias() {
        
$str "SELECT * FROM noticias ORDER BY not_fecha DESC";
        
$rs $this->EjecutarQuery($str);
        
$nr $this->NumeroFilas($rs);
        
        
$res "<table>";
        
$res .= "<tr>";
        
$res .= "<th>C&oacute;digo</th>";
        
$res .= "<th>Fecha</th>";
        
$res .= "<th>Tema</th>";
        
$res .= "<th>Resumen</th>";
        
$res .= "<th>Activo</th>";
        
$res .= "</tr>";

        if (
$nr 0) {
            while (
$arr $this->RetornarFilas($rs)) {
                
$res .= "<tr>";
                
$res .= "<td>".$arr[0]."</td>";
                
$res .= "<td>".date("d/m/Y"strtotime($arr[1]))."</td>";
                
$res .= "<td>".$arr[2]."</td>";
                
$res .= "<td>".$arr[3]."</td>";
                
$res .= "<td>".$arr[6]."</td>";
                
$res .= "</tr>";
            }
        }
        else {
            
$res .= "<tr>";
            
$res .= "<td colspan='5'>No hay noticias publicadas.</td>";
            
$res .= "</tr>";
        }
        
        
        
$res .= "</table>";
        
        echo 
$res;
    } 
la consulta ya la probe, si devuelve resultados y las 2 lineas siguientes, ya las use anteriormente, en ralidad toda la funcion con otros datos y otra tabla ya la use y si mostraba los datos, pero ahora no se que pasa, quizas hay algun error de sintaxis que no haya visto. Espero que me puedas ayudar. Gracias.
__________________
El aprendiz.